Tanning Mishaps
Help! You applied a self-tanner and now your legs are streaked and your face is orange! What can you do?

To lessen the appearance of streaks in your self-tan, use a cotton ball soaked in a 2% alpha-hydroxy solution. Your “tan” is only in the top dead layer of skin cells, so exfoliating will remove some of the color. Use a loofah or a body scrub, but don’t be too harsh. For your face, a bronzing powder can help reduce the orange and even out the color, but don’t use too much.
Most importantly, relax. Your “tan” will naturally fade in three to four days.
